Union Duke: UD IV
Union Duke: UD IV UD IV is Union Duke's fourth full-length studio album and their first major album release in a decade. It marks a transition with the departure of original bass player Will Staunton halfway through the recording. The album was completed by the four remaining members, Matt Warry-Smith, Ethan Smith, Jim McDonald, and Rob McLaren, with the addition of Ian McKeown on bass.
